@User public static class Element_head.Choice_2_Alt_1 extends Element_head.Choice_2 implements Visitable<Visitor>, Matchable<BaseMatcher>
TypedNode.ParseListener<E extends TypedElement<?,?>>
TypedContent.DecodingConstructor<C extends TypedContent,X extends TypedExtension,Y extends Exception>, TypedContent.ParsingConstructor<C extends TypedContent,E extends TypedElement<E,X>,X extends TypedExtension,Y extends Exception>
Modifier and Type | Field and Description |
---|---|
static int |
ALT_INDEX |
altIndex
Constructor and Description |
---|
Choice_2_Alt_1(Element_title elem_1_title,
Element_head.Choice_2_Alt_1_Choice_1[] choices_1,
Element_head.Choice_2_Alt_1_Seq_1 seq_1) |
alt, alt, isAlt_1, isAlt_2, set, toAlt_1, toAlt_2
getAltIndex
asBigDecimal, asBigDecimal, asBigDecimal, asBigDecimal, asBigInteger, asBigInteger, asBigInteger, asBigInteger, asBoolean, asBoolean, asDouble, asDouble, asDouble, asDouble, asFloat, asFloat, asFloat, asFloat, asHexInt, asHexInt, asHexInt, asHexInt, asInt, asInt, asInt, asInt, asLong, asLong, asLong, asLong, asTrimmedString, asTrimmedString, asTrimmedString, asTrimmedString, checkPlus, checkPlus, checkStar, checkStar, checkStrict, encode, encodeOptional, encodePlus, encodePlus, encodeStar, encodeStar, extractEthereals, getLocation, getPCData, setLocation, setLocation, setLocation
public static final int ALT_INDEX
public Choice_2_Alt_1(Element_title elem_1_title, Element_head.Choice_2_Alt_1_Choice_1[] choices_1, Element_head.Choice_2_Alt_1_Seq_1 seq_1)
@User public void set(Element_title elem_1_title, Element_head.Choice_2_Alt_1_Choice_1[] choices_1, Element_head.Choice_2_Alt_1_Seq_1 seq_1)
public final void encode(EncodingOutputStream out, Extension ext) throws IOException
TypedNode
encode
in class TypedNode<Extension>
IOException
public void __dumpElementSnapshot(List<TypedSubstantial<Extension>> list)
__dumpElementSnapshot
in class Element_head.Choice_2
@User public Element_title getElem_1_title()
@User public Element_title setElem_1_title(Element_title newElem_1_title)
@User public Element_head.Choice_2_Alt_1_Choice_1[] getChoices_1()
@User public Element_head.Choice_2_Alt_1_Choice_1 getChoice_1(int index)
public int countChoices_1()
@User public Element_head.Choice_2_Alt_1_Choice_1 setChoice_1(int index, Element_head.Choice_2_Alt_1_Choice_1 newChoice_1)
@User public Element_head.Choice_2_Alt_1_Choice_1[] setChoices_1(Element_head.Choice_2_Alt_1_Choice_1... newChoices_1)
@User public boolean hasSeq_1()
@User @Opt public @Opt Element_head.Choice_2_Alt_1_Seq_1 getSeq_1()
@User public Element_head.Choice_2_Alt_1_Seq_1 setSeq_1(@Opt @Opt Element_head.Choice_2_Alt_1_Seq_1 newSeq_1)
public static Element_head.Choice_2_Alt_1 parse(SAXEventStream in, Extension ext, TypedNode.ParseListener<Element> listener) throws TdomAttributeException, TdomXmlException, TdomContentException
public void host(Visitor visitor)
Visitable
host
in interface Visitable<Visitor>
host
in class Element_head.Choice_2
public void identify(BaseMatcher matcher)
identify
in interface Matchable<BaseMatcher>
identify
in class Element_head.Choice_2
see also the complete user documentation .